Door screens are mesh barriers installed in door frames to allow ventilation while preventing insects from entering your home. They play a critical role in maintaining indoor air quality and comfort during warmer months.

The cost varies based on several factors including material quality and labor charges but generally ranges between $100-$300 per unit.
Yes, but without proper tools or experience, it may lead to further complications requiring professional intervention later on.
Inspect them at least twice a year; however, if you notice visible damage sooner than that—get them checked!
Most use high-quality fiberglass mesh due to its durability; however, aluminum options exist as well based on customer preference.
Yes! Most reputable companies offer warranties ranging from six months up to two years based on service provided.
